Navigating Top Cloud-Based Providers: Choosing the Right Solution for Your Needs
In today's shifting digital landscape, cloud computing has become an integral component for businesses of all sizes. Featuring a myriad of cloud providers available, choosing the perfect solution for your specific needs cloud infrastructures can be a challenging task.
To begin, it's vital to identify your business requirements. Consider factors such as file needs, execution power, security protocols, and cost considerations.
- Popular cloud providers like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ud Platform (GCP) offer a comprehensive range of services to meet diverse requirements.
- Thoroughly research each provider's features, pricing models, and credibility within the industry.
- Moreover, seek out testimonials from other businesses that have utilized these platforms to gain practical knowledge.
By conducting a thorough evaluation and matching your choices with your individual needs, you can select the cloud provider that optimizes for your business goals.

Harnessing the Power of Cloud Computing: Benefits and Challenges
Cloud computing has revolutionized the technological landscape, offering a multitude of perks for businesses and individuals alike. One of the primary benefits is scalability, allowing users to resize their resources on demand. This adaptability ensures that organizations can seamlessly scale up or down based on their present needs.
Furthermore, cloud computing provides optimized security measures, protecting sensitive data from threats. Reputable cloud providers invest heavily in state-of-the-art infrastructure to safeguard user information.
However, despite its many advantages, cloud computing also presents certain obstacles. One notable challenge is confidentiality, as data stored in the cloud may be subject to legal mandates. Another concern is dependence on a third-party provider, which can create vulnerabilities if the provider faces interruptions.
It's crucial for organizations to carefully consider both the benefits and challenges of cloud computing before making the transition.
